evo wheels are enkeis RS-6 with a mistubishi center cap...its cheaper just to buy the rs-6 i seen them run for a set of 17's with tires for 880 on the internet shipped to your door and buy the caps from mistu....
 
while we are on the subject, i kinda like the EVO VII wheels. i saw a set kinda like those on a black 1g in the gallery a while back. does anyone know what brand etc.... they are?
 
they are not rs-6's. my friend has an evo, and my other friend has a prelude with rs-6's on it, they are totally differen't. And plus it seems most enkei's are usually 17x7, and the evos are 17x8. also the evo wheels have bigger holes for the lugnuts, me and 2 other friends have enkeis, and the holes for the lugs are pretty tyte, and so when we take out our lugs, sumtimes we nick the rims leavin little scratches which is really annoying. anyway, ya they are NOT rs-6 rims

anyone know how much do the stock 2003-2004 evo 8 wheels weight? :confused:
 
Yeah, I was thinking bout puttin them on my car, what you guys think?
 
Too heavy for what they will end up costing you.
now if they were free or sub 400 for the set, I'd say go for it, still 5 lbs lighter than a 97 GSX rim.

You can find 17-19 lb rims all day for 500-800 a set.
